Carrie Lomax

38 books

764 pages digital

fiction romance emotional mysterious fast-paced

116 pages digital

fiction historical romance adventurous lighthearted mysterious fast-paced

427 pages 2019

romance lighthearted fast-paced

missing page info

emotional reflective sad slow-paced

127 pages digital 2020

fiction historical romance emotional medium-paced

missing duration info audio

130 pages digital 2019

fiction romance adventurous emotional hopeful fast-paced

1635 pages

emotional lighthearted fast-paced